I don't know if this is even possible, but there is a debian build (.deb) of the Google Play Music Manager available.

It would be nice if it was possible to install this on a Syno box and have the contents of a Music share automatically synced to Google Play Music.

The debian installs can be found at: http://www.ubuntuupdates.org/package/google_music/stable/main/base/google-musicmanager-beta

AFAIK source is not available and binaries are only for x86, it's Xorg app with unsure whatever it can be use headless, it provides only one functionality - syncing music with Google Music. Maybe some unofficial apps for syncing but this particular one stands no chance here.

There is a new alternative that seems promising:

https://github.com/thebigmunch/google-music-scripts

It's a Python module for headless command-line functions to interoperate with Google Music, uploading music in same fashion as the desktop app. One challenge is that it requires Python 3.6 but most current supported version is 3.5.1.

So, multiple challenges... having Python 3.6 working on Synology then addressing any incompatibilities in running google-music-scripts on Synology rather than on a more standard Linux distro.
